As Turkey strives to enhance its energy infrastructure and meet the criteria for European Union membership, a promising avenue emerges in the form of vehicle-to-grid (V2G) technology. V2G technology facilitates a two-way flow of electricity between electric vehicles (EVs) and the power grid, offering a host of benefits such as grid stability, energy efficiency, and cost savings. This innovation is not only crucial for achieving sustainable energy goals but also aligning with the EU's ambitious climate targets. Turkey's strategic geographical location makes it a key player in bridging the gap between Europe and Asia, and V2G technology can further solidify its position as a sustainable energy leader in the region. By leveraging the growing popularity of EVs and implementing V2G infrastructure, Turkey can reduce its carbon footprint, enhance grid flexibility, and optimize energy usage. One of the primary challenges in Turkey's path to EU membership lies in meeting the stringent environmental standards set by the European Union. By embracing V2G technology, Turkey can showcase its commitment to sustainability and innovation, addressing key criteria for accession to the EU. Moreover, V2G technology can foster collaboration and partnerships with EU member states, enhancing Turkey's integration into the European energy market. The potential benefits of V2G technology extend beyond environmental considerations, offering economic advantages as well. By enabling EV owners to sell excess energy back to the grid, V2G technology can create new revenue streams and incentivize the adoption of electric mobility. This can drive economic growth, job creation, and technological advancement in Turkey, positioning the country as a frontrunner in the transition to a low-carbon economy. Furthermore, V2G technology can enhance energy security and resilience, reducing dependency on imported fossil fuels and diversifying the energy mix. This not only strengthens Turkey's energy independence but also aligns with the EU's objectives of promoting renewable energy sources and combating climate change.
